Windows Defender: Malware Defense at the OS Level

Windows Defender, more formally Microsoft Defender Antivirus serves as Microsoft’s native system security application, is offered by default in every Windows 10/11 system. It supports continual protection for your operating system. Helping block malware, spyware, rootkits, viruses, and more.
